Step back in time with 'The Atlantic Monthly, Vol. 12, No. 74, December, 1863,' a captivating glimpse into 19th-century American literature and thought. This meticulously reprinted edition offers a curated selection of essays, short stories, and poetry originally published in the esteemed periodical.Explore the diverse voices and perspectives that shaped American culture during a pivotal era. Immerse yourself in the literary landscape of the time, encountering works that reflect the social, political, and artistic currents of the 19th century United States.This volume provides a unique window into the past, offering insights into American history and the evolution of American literary styles. Discover the enduring power of storytelling and the timeless relevance of the themes explored within these pages. A treasure for enthusiasts of American literature and historical periodicals.This work has been selected by scholars as being culturally important, and is part of the knowledge base of civilization as we know it.This work is in the public domain in the United States of America, and possibly other nations.
